In a remarkable and broad-ranging narrative, Yangwen Zheng''s book explores the history of opium consumption in China from 1483 to the late twentieth century. The story begins in the mid-Ming dynasty, when opium was sent as a gift by vassal states and used as an aphrodisiac in court.
